Riot makes more cuts, this time to crown jewel League of Legends
Briefly

Marc Merrill stated, "This isn't about reducing headcount to save money-it's about making sure we have the right expertise so that League continues to be great for another 15 years and beyond." This underscores a focus on quality and future stability instead of immediate financial savings.
Merrill emphasized, "we're not slowing down work on the game you love" indicating that despite the job cuts, efforts surrounding League of Legends will remain strong and prioritization of the team's direction is key for future developments.
Changes at Riot suggest a strategic shift as the company is narrowing its focus, potentially moving away from experimental projects and towards ensuring the success of League of Legends and its community.
Riot Games has undertaken major restructuring initiatives lately, including cutting 33 roles specifically related to League of Legends, which occur amid a high-stakes esports season, highlighting a determination to remain competitive.
